ASTM D7298 Legibility Testing for Pavement Markings by Polarizing Filter

ASTM D7298 test method defines a standard technique for assessing the comparative legibility of printed matter under consistent and controlled light conditions using a specialized instrument. The printed matter to be tested are the package labeling, printed inserts, and carton graphics. The test method aids in determining the impact of layout, typeface, type size, color, and background on printed matter legibility.

    Overview

    ASTM D7298 describes a test method for measuring the comparative legibility of printed or displayed text and graphics using polarizing filter instrumentation. Legibility is a critical optical property for signage, displays, labels, and printed documents where information must be clearly discernable under varying lighting conditions, including ambient glare.

    The method provides a quantitative, instrument-based measure of legibility that reduces the subjectivity of visual inspection and supports objective comparison of display or print technologies.

    Test Process

    Instrument Setup

    The polarizing filter photometer is aligned and calibrated; illumination geometry is set per the standard specification.

    1

    Baseline Measurement

    Luminance or reflectance of the background and character areas is measured without polarizing filters to establish baseline contrast.

    2

    Polarized Measurement

    Measurements are repeated with a polarizing filter; legibility index is derived from filtered vs. unfiltered data.

    3

    Comparative Reporting

    Legibility indices are compared and ranked, with results reported alongside geometry and illumination conditions.
